主页 > 华为安装imtoken > 比特币交易手续费的收取原则是什么?

比特币交易手续费的收取原则是什么?

华为安装imtoken 2023-12-21 05:13:40

比特币主要使用椭圆曲线数字签名算法(ECDSA),它有两个至关重要的特点:第一,只要知道私钥,就可以计算出对应的公钥; 第二,你用私钥签名 对于已经签名的东西比特币钱包原理,你可以用公钥来计算是否是你签名的。

事实上,比特币在交易过程中是没有钱包的,只有交易单,整个比特币交易就是很多交易单。 比如账单1,从A给B,转了X个比特币; 账单2,B给C、D,转了X个比特币; 账单3比特币钱包原理,从C到E,转了X个比特币……只要下载客户端,就可以收到比特币成立之日起的所有账单。 所以,只要把所有的账单都下载下来,自然就知道每个账户应该剩下多少钱了。 每一张比特币交易单都是一个数据,签名后会发送到全网。

下面将数据结构反转成通俗易懂的中文解释,如下:

FROM(发件人)

由两部分组成:一是Previous Tx,也就是说花的任何一笔钱都要转给你,需要出示账单ID; 另一种是Script Si,就是用你的私钥对bill进行hash(ha Greek算法),只有你自己可以做这个Hash。

TO(谁接受了)

这包括两部分:一是Vae,即发送多少; 另一个是Script Pub Key,即对方的公钥,比特币账户就是公钥。

签署表格后,开始向全网发送。 如何发送? 比特币通信非常简单,可以比作 iRC 频道。 与普通IRC的区别在于它的客户端是一个IRC服务器。 客户端启动时,会收到周围有公网P的客户端地址,即“服务器”列表。 这个列表会不断刷新,都是其他比特币用户,如果你在这个IRC“喊”一句话,你周围的人都会听到,然后就会传遍全世界。

将签名后的账单发送到世界各地后,收到账单的客户将验证账单是否正确。 例如,验证您的签名,是否是您发送的; 验证你是否有这么多钱。 经过计算,如果发现交易没问题,基本就认为转账成功了。 现在,即使对方接受了比特币,如果他们想花钱,也必须有那个地址对应的私钥(公钥)等等。 这就是比特币交易的运作方式。